Zongos Don’t Deserve Football Pitches . . . - Naziru Mohammed

Member of the opposition National Democratic Congress (NDC) Communication Team, Alhaji Naziru Mohammed has described footballers as people who do not have what it takes to become President of the Republic of Ghana.

According to him, qualified people for the Presidency are those who have gone to school to study law and other professions to acquire knowledge and not mere professional footballers without governance knowledge.

Speaking on Okay FM’s 'Ade Akye Abia' Morning Show, he claimed that the Akufo-Addo government has reduced Zongos to only football professionals and also people who are only good for entertainment and not educated people to rub shoulders with them in the country.

He added that President Akufo-Addo’s father did not build a gym for him even though he [Nana Addo] loves boxing, but rather educated him to become a renowned lawyer who is now President of the Republic; wondering why President Akufo-Addo only saw the needs of Zongos to be constructing football pitches and not to see them climb the academic ladder.

“Akufo-Addo likes boxing and why didn’t his father build him a gym to learn how to box but rather sent him to school to become a lawyer . . .  when it comes to the Presidency, we cannot use football profession to become a President, we rather use law and other acquired knowledge in schools to become President,” he asserted.

He said Dr. Bawumia and the NDC do not come nowhwere close to the contribution of the NDC in Zongos in terms of infrastructural development like constructing gutters, roads, community centres and classrooms.

“The place where Dr Bawumia made those comments, former President Mahama has constructed 18 unit classroom blocks for the Zongo kids and not a football pitch for the kids to learn how to play,” he stated.

“Dr Bawumia is now telling us that he has built playing grounds for the Zongos and so he has solved our problems for us. We want to tell him that we are discerning now and we want to see progress in terms of acquiring knowledge as we have seen others acquiring in order to add their quota to the socio-economic development of the country," he mentioned.

He, therefore, stressed that the NDC sees Zongos as their par and not a group of people afar from the socio-economic development of the country; adding that the NDC is ready and prepared to support people from the Zongo to occupy the highest position of the land without any discrimination.
